Tips for Filling out Your Employment Activities on the SF-86 List ALL jobs beginning with the present and back 10 full years with no breaks. Do NOT list tentative or future employment. Do not stretch employment dates to fill gaps when you were really unemployed for a month or more.

FACT: Section 21 (Psychological and Emotional Health) of the SF86 requires applicants and employees to provide information about current or prior mental health treatment under the following circumstances: If a court or administrative agency has ever declared you mentally incompetent.

If you lie on the SF-86, you could face fines and/or up-to five years in prison. Even if you omit information, that information could be discovered and would be perceived the same as lying.
